The Business Side of Beauty
Running a luxury brand isn’t all silk and champagne; it’s also spreadsheets, logistics, and yes, managing tax documentation. This is where AI’s less glamorous but wildly effective skills come into play. Advanced tools can comb through mountains of financial records, flag discrepancies, and even predict seasonal market shifts with startling accuracy.
But what about the personal touch? That’s where smart brands get it right. By automating the tedious, they free up time for the kind of bespoke attention clients expect—like hand-written notes or an invitation to an exclusive showroom. AI does the heavy lifting in the background, letting the brand bask in its polished glow.

The Sustainability Factor
Luxury and sustainability haven’t always been besties. But AI might just be the bridge that brings them together. From predicting how much fabric to order to reducing waste in production, AI is helping brands create with precision.
Take custom orders, for example. By analyzing customer data, AI can help brands offer tailored pieces without overproducing. Suddenly, the idea of a truly “made-for-you” piece feels not just achievable but ethical. And while sustainability isn’t a trend—it’s a necessity—using AI to streamline these processes makes it a lot more appealing to both brands and their buyers.
